lock Can I play Giant's Blood on an uncontrolled vampire?

25 Aug 2012 23:37 - 25 Aug 2012 23:38 #35351 by mirddes
1994 card text

If this is the first time Giant's blood is being played in the game, restore a vampire to full capacity from the blood bank. If this is not the first time, then Giant's Blood is burned with no effect.

1995 card text

Restore a vampire to full capacity with blood from the blood bank. Only one giant's blood can be played in a game.

2002 card text

Restore a vampire to full capacity with blood from the blood bank. Only 1 Giants Blood can be played in a game.

LoB

Restore a vampire to full capacity with blood from the blood bank. Only one Giants Blood can be played in a game.

2008

Fill a vampire to full capacity with blood from the blood bank. Only one Giants Blood can be played in a game.



----


this much more recent card text makes the ready/uncontrolled situation clearer. past card texts state RESTORE, 2008 onward state FILL.

restore indicates the vampire already had blood on it.
fill has no such premise.

There is no text on this card specifying non-standard targets (unlike for instance on Enchant Kindred, Govern the Unaligned or Tend the Flock) therefore, it follows the rules. Since it follows the rules, you cannot choose an uncontrolled vampire for Giant's Blood.

To stop you putting the card on someone else's vampire. You can play Giant's Blood on any ready vampire (including ones you do not control). So rather than saying "Fill a ready vampire to capacity" the text relies on the Targeting rule to allow you to only target cards in play.

1.6.1.4 Restricts you to targeting cards which are controlled or 'in play' unless there is specific card text. Uncontrolled vampires are not 'in play' and therefore cannot be targeted by a huge number of other cards.

You cannot put discipline cards on uncontrolled vampires due to 1.6.1.4
You cannot play Anachronism on an uncontrolled vampire due to 1.6.1.4
You cannot play Society of Leopold on an uncontrolled vampire due to 1.6.1.4

So you can't choose an uncontrolled vampire for Giant's Blood.
